"He said, one day you'll leave this world behind, so live a life you will remember". The opening lyrics of the chorus of Avicii's 'The Nights', and lyrics that now have a much deeper meaning following the shock announcement of the Swedish DJ's untimely death last Friday. They are also the lyrics of the song that makes a debut straight in at #1 on my chart this week. 'The Nights' is not alone, either. Far from it. It is joined by 2 other of Avicii's songs in the Top 10 as 'Without You' re-enters at #7, by far beating its previous peak of #36, and 'Waiting For Love' debuts at #10. There are also an additional 5 songs in the rest of the chart, at #16, #22, #28, #34 & #38, making for a total of 8 Avicii songs in the chart this week. With 7 brand new debuts to the chart this week, Avicii matches the record set by Camila Cabello upon the release of her debut album for the most simultaneous debuts in 1 week. Rest in peace to one of the best EDM producers of all time.
